WGET / cron baixando o arquivo webcamera

0

nosso novo médico da cidade colocou uma câmera na sua sala de espera para as pessoas verem o quanto ela está lotada. Como minha mãe e meus avós vão ao médico, eu queria baixar os arquivos periodicamente e se eles fossem capturados lá, eu queria enviar a foto para eles. Infantil, eu sei, mas eu só tenho que alimentar minha procrastinação durante o período do exame. :) Agora, para o meu problema.

Na página web do médico, há a foto da câmera web. A imagem é atualizada a cada 60 segundos. Se eu clicar com o botão direito do mouse sobre ele e selecionar "Mostrar foto em uma nova guia", há a foto com um link limpo, sem material dinâmico, assim como link . Além disso, o mesmo link está dentro do código-fonte da página.

Eu tenho o servidor doméstico Ubuntu 14.04 32bit. Fiz um script (veja em baixo) e adicionei ao cron para rodar a cada minuto ... funciona bem, as imagens estão sendo criadas.

!/bin/bash

datum=$(date +"%Y%m%d-%H%M%S")

wget http://page.com/image.jpg -O /srv/2000raid/Test/image-$datum.jpg

Mas o problema é que o arquivo baixado é o mesmo para cerca de 10-11 fotos seguintes. E, em seguida, 10-11 fotos seguintes são diferentes, então o lote anterior, mas todos parecem iguais. Etc ...

MAS - a imagem na web está mudando.

Então eu acho que pode haver algum problema com o cache no servidor, eu tentei wget --no-cache e wget --cache = off ... mas nada ajudou ...

Alguma idéia, por favor? :)

PS: Eu não estou escrevendo aqui o link real porque eu tenho medo que ela não ficaria muito feliz se houvesse algum brincalhão tentando mexer com seu servidor baixando o arquivo a cada segundo ou algo parecido ...

    
por user329804 05.06.2014 / 22:35

1 resposta

0

No topo da minha cabeça, não sei por que isso estaria acontecendo. Eu sugeriria tentar em vez de cada minuto a cada 5 minutos.

Gostaria de verificar se você obtém os mesmos resultados usando cURL O equivalente cURL do seu wget seria semelhante curl -s -o /srv/2000raid/Test/image-$datum.jpg http://page.com/image.jpg

    
por 05.06.2014 / 22:54